On keg at Draft House, Hammersmith. Pours a hazy pale yellow with a foamy top. Aroma: biscuit malts, herbal, citrus, lemon., spices. Taste: dry, mildly bitter, citrus lemon, light spices. Light bodied with foamy carb. Light dry finish. Slightly strange to use sorachi hops in a delicate kolsch. Was interesting but not sure it works

330ml can into glass. Aroma of sweet dough, spice and a little fruit. Excellent. Pale yellow beer with a thin clingy head. Low carbonation. Grainy taste, bitter fruity finish. Long lingering fruity bitterness at the end. Unusual Kölsch but a nice beer in it’s own right.

Bottled at Cookie, Melbourne, Victoria. Hazy golden, mid sized head.Cocoa aroma. Mid sweet with light-medium body and rounded mouthfeel. Cocoa, lemon yoghurt and vanilla. Mid bitter finish, A good beer, but it shares little similarities to anything I would describe as a kölsch.

From the tap at the Local Taphouse, St Kilda on 27/1/2011 (part of a five beer tasting paddle). Light straw colour in the glass. Has an interesting aroma of bread, dough, spices, lemon, and wet paint. Flavour wise, you get lots of lemon/cirus, with a distinct and quite impressive sweet/sour balance. A very unusual and quite impressive brew, which will please those who like a bit of ’in your face’ bitterness.
